Pesticides
Chemical agents used to kill or control pests that damage crops and spread diseases, including insecticides, herbicides, and fungicides.
Fertilizer Runoff
The movement of water-soluble components of fertilizer from agricultural lands to nearby water bodies, potentially causing nutrient pollution and algal blooms.
Smokestack
A large, tall chimney through which combustion gases and smoke are discharged, commonly seen in industrial plants and ships.
Persistence
The ability of a substance to remain in the environment for a long time without breaking down.
